YEAGLEY, Associate Judge, Retired:
In June 1979, appellee, the Jonathan Woodner Company, filed individual suits against appellants for possession of units they occupied at 2440 16th Street, N.W., the Park Towers Apartments. Appellants, members of the Park Towers Tenants Association, had ceased paying rent in May 1979 because of the alleged existence of housing code violations and a reduction in managerial services.
